I remember ITM being rumored on here a year or 2 prior to its actual release, and I agree that a new Christine solo album would be very much appreciated. My favourites from that album are "Givin it back", "Friend", "Bad Journey" and "Sweet Revenge". I enjoyed the RNB sound of "Forgiveness", a lot, too, but I had been hoping for more of her own keyboard work than such a high number of funk rhythm guitar. Still, it's probably down to who's the guitarist and what does the producer want. I'd be very happy if she'd invite Billy Burnette and Michael Thompson (that solo on "Hollywood (Some Other Kind of Town)" is fabulous) to the sessions, and would love it if she'd dare to prominently feature herself playing vintage keyboards from the 70s and 80s.
Hopefully, she'll find a label to license the new record to, because Sanctuary Records, who released ITM is not in business anymore, if I remember correctly. My suggestion for that would be Proper Records from the UK, because they've got some experience with marketing artists in the 2nd half of their careers. |
